The Best New Summer Reads

Carsick: John Waters Hitchhikes Across America

By John Waters

Farrar, Straus and Giroux

If you’re not planning your own trip across America this summer, here’s how to do it vicariously: Writer, director, and all around eccentric human, John Waters has documented his experience hitchhiking across the country. It’s as campy as you can imagine, but still enjoyable for casual fans.


The Son

by Jo Nesbø

Knopf

By Norwegian author and musician, Jo Nesbø, The Son is a revenge story of a strange young man imprisoned for a crime he didn’t commit. Nesbø, known for his Harry Hole detective series, departs from that award winning series for this stand-alone novel.


Mr. Mercedes

By Stephen King

Scribner

This is not your typical Stephen King story. There are no mystical forces, no magic, ghosts, or zombies. Just a maniacal killer with only one weapon: his car. Ok, so Stephen King does love cars, but this one is not your typical possessed type. This war between good and evil will hold you until the final pages.


The News: A User’s Manual

By Alain De Botton

Pantheon

I bet you like to read the news, because, well you’re reading this newspaper right now. Through a philosophical lens, author Alain De Botton examines the frenzy of news we are bombarded with these daily. Why can’t we hear enough stories about natural disaster, murders, and celebrity meltdowns? De Botton tries to answer these questions.


A New Leaf: The End of Cannabis Prohibition

By Alyson Martin and Nushin Rashidian

New Press

In 2012, the people of Colorado and Washington states voted to legalize the production and sale of marijuana. Many states allow access to medical marijuana, and those that don’t yet will probably soon follow (New York Governor Andrew Cuomo recently announced an agreement to hold clinical trials for marijuana-based medication for children who have seizures while the Compassionate Care Act, a wider bill, works through the state Senate). A New Leaf: The End of Cannabis Prohibition takes a look at the war on weed from every angle. Investigative journalists Alyson Martin and Nushin Rashidian have been commended for their evenhanded take on the subject in this interesting, and deep analysis of cannabis.


Summer House with Swimming Pool

By Herman Koch

Hogarth

Out this week, Summer House with Swimming Pool is about a doctor who exclusively treats celebrities. Fearful that his reputation will be tarnished when a medical procedure goes horribly wrong, he seeks to hide the truth. This horror story should keep you hooked.


The Book of Unknown Americans: A Novel

By Cristina Henriquez

Knopf

What seems like a fairly ordinary narrative about a Latino immigrant family becomes a cross-cultural love story right under your nose in The Book of Unknown Americans: A Novel. After moving to America following a tragic accident in their hometown in Mexico, the family in this story struggles with racism, finding jobs, and simply feeding each other. Henriquez’s book is storytelling at its finest.
